10 Greatest Hits Fernando Ortega Songs

Fernando Ortega Songs are famous worldwide. The family of the worship leader Fernando Ortega lived in artisans and weavers for eight generations and lived in Chimayo, New Mexico (a village on the banks of the Rio Grande).

People Also Ask (FAQs)

Who is Fernando Ortega?

Juan Fernando Ortega is a singer-songwriter in contemporary Christian music. He is noted both for his interpretations of many traditional hymns and songs, such as “Give Me Jesus” and “Be Thou My Vision”, and for writing clear and easily understood songs such as “This Good Day”.

Which is the most popular album by Fernando Ortega?

Hymns and Meditation is one of the most popular and best-selling albums of Fernando Ortega. His soulful voice has made people get attached to these songs and have increased his fan following
